We received ours too for $1600 (4 family members). AND we were just barely eligible - we established residence in AB on 1st Sep 05. To receive the cheque, you had to be a resident of AB as of 1 Sept. 05. We werent even sure they would have all our information (although we had sent a letter to CRA with our new address) and we thought we would have to call multiple times and submit documents (like rent agreements) to show that we were eligible. To our surprise the cheques were in our mailbox on the due date without requiring any calls.
